Canada - Import of P-Xylene

Since 2014, Canada Import of P-Xylene decreased by 37.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 19 comparing other countries in Import of P-Xylene at $2,475,511. Canada is overtaken by Poland, which was number 18 with $9,944,480 and is followed by Germany with $2,465,006.25. China topped the ranking with $16,417,779,560.45 in 2019, a decrease of 3.1% versus 2018. India, Indonesia and Mexico resp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. United Arab Emirates recorded the best 5 years average growth at +229% per year, while Tunisia witnessed the worst performance at -75.4% per year.
